Transaction 160645748857fa3547fd16db516fa07cb1971bd02d2781294d14804bf1f83b90
1 Input
1 Output
-
160645748857fa3547fd16db516fa07cb1971bd02d2781294d14804bf1f83b90:0
- value
- 762656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 514632177b12bb472c65fb989bd87363afff3501 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18QjppW2p8Pf8s7fTajiij4nZXpah87Nwo